diff --git a/backend/server/api/coach/message.post.ts b/backend/server/api/coach/message.post.ts index 2de84b8..cdc4830 100644 --- a/backend/server/api/coach/message.post.ts +++ b/backend/server/api/coach/message.post.ts @@ -651,7 +651,7 @@ export default defineEventHandler(async (event) => { } // Feedback-Detection + LLM parallel starten - const lastUserMsg = [...messages].reverse().find((m) => m.role === "user"); + // (lastUserMsg ist bereits oben für Sprach-Detection berechnet) const feedbackPromise = lastUserMsg?.content ? detectAndSaveFeedback(lastUserMsg.content, user.id, config) : Promise.resolve(false);